The role of online gambling commissions
Regulatory bodies licence legitimate online casinos to legally offer their gambling services.
But before they do that, they require the following from every applicant.
- Criminal background check
- The operating model, including bonus implementation, deposits, payouts, jackpots, server, and site security,
- Third Party Providers: Fraud Detection, Age Identity, Geolocation
- Software Technical Standards—Submission of Independent Game Tests
- A significant down payment or licence fee.
Every agency has different rules and regulations.
An authority like the UK Gambling Commission is hands-on and is constantly updating its guidelines and safe casino practices. Others are less proactive, but still have procedures in place to protect players.

How the UKGC is leading the way in online gambling regulation
You can’t get much better than the UK Gambling Commission’s support when it comes to safe online gambling.
It is a proactive commission that regulates gambling in physical locations and online casinos.
In addition to the licencing process, the Commission is continuously developing its rules and practises to ensure that gambling is safe for UK casino players.
Here are a few examples of recent changes made by the UKGC.
- In 2020, the UKGC will take credit cards off the table, preventing players from betting “on credit”.
- They imposed a limit on slot speeds.
- The UKGC prohibits any feature or reward that speeds up the game.
- They force casinos to prominently display total losses and gains for players.
The UKGC wasted no time in putting these new regulations into practice. They told online operators they had until the following October to comply.

A few states, such as New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and West Virginia, also have state-regulated gambling and gambling sites.
In New Jersey, for example, the online casinos are in partnership with the casino resorts of Atlantic City. Users can fund their accounts in person and then play remotely as long as they are within state lines.
Online gambling is strictly regulated in the state of New Jersey, and these operations in the state are the foundation of some of the safest online casinos that accept US players.
However, problems can arise at even the most reputable online casinos.
For example, some New Jersey casino sites have received warnings for promoting reverse withdrawals. Players complained about two-week payouts and receiving incentives to cancel their withdrawal requests.
This situation shows the power of proper licencing and regulation behind safe online casino gambling when the Gaming Enforcement department gets involved.
The advisory bulletin is the first step, and you can rest assured that additional action will follow in the event of non-compliance.

Low Deposit Limits
The average daily deposit limits are somewhere between 2,500 and 3,000. Safe casino sites stick to that relatively lower limit. If you’re worried about going over your budget, stay away from high-roller online casinos, which allow deposits of $10,000 or more.
Player Tools
The safest real-money online casinos provide every user with various gambling control tools in their account area. Players can limit the frequency and amount of their deposits and must also be able to set session time limits.
Self-exclusion
One of the best gambling control tools is the option to self-exclude for a period of time. That means players will want to deny access to the site for ten days, a month, or even longer. Of course, there is no stopping anyone from opening a new gambling account and playing elsewhere. Nevertheless, reputable online casinos still offer the service.
No chargebacks
Some betting committees have taken reverse withdrawals off the table. In other locations, trusted online casinos do not allow players to change their mind after submitting withdrawal requests.

Segregated funds
If you’ve ever made a down payment to move into a rental home, you know that the owner or landlord needs to put that money in a separate account. It should stay put until you leave.
If the landlord uses it, there’s no guarantee you’ll get what you owe.
It’s the same scenario for gambling sites. Most reputable casino operators have separate accounts for players’ deposits and winnings, with enough money to cover payouts.
If you read casino reviews or see patterns in player feedback that mention longer payout turnaround times, treat that as a red flag.

Site Security
This aspect of finding safe online casino sites should apply to every website you visit.
Site security includes the website itself and the payment processing performed through the website. One of the first things to look for when opening an online casino is a lock next to the URL (at the top of your screen).
If you don’t see that slot, or worse, if you get a warning about the site’s security, your best bet is to move on and find a safe casino. The lock indicates that the site has a valid security certificate.
Another way to identify a safe casino is to check the URL for “HTTP” or “HTTPS”. If a website has an SSL (secure sockets layer), or security certificate, it starts with HTTPS.
Site security also extends to payment processing. Even some of the safest real money casino sites don’t always list payment processing information in the footer area.
However, you should see some mention of secure transactions in the terms and conditions or banking page.

Keep your computer or mobile device safe!
There is no need to have the latest iPhone that just came out every year or buy a new computer.
But if you have older equipment, keep in mind software updates, antivirus protection, and other security measures.
Older hardware or software that has not been continuously updated is vulnerable to hacking. If your casino login and banking information are made public, you could end up in a lot of trouble.
So you may be using a legit, high-rated online casino to keep your information safe and secure, but it’s unprotected on your end.
Use a secure WiFi connection.
It doesn’t matter if you visit online casino sites or mobile gambling apps from the comfort of your home, over your private Wi-Fi connection.
If you haven’t secured your connection with quality passwords, you’re asking for a virtual invasion.
There are quite a few people who plug in their modem and Wi-Fi router under the assumption that it is safe. Meanwhile, the whole neighbourhood has access.
Avoid using free connections.
It’s tempting to sit in a coffee shop or waiting room and use free WiFi to save some data on your smartphone.
However, if you plan on using real-money casino apps, you may want to reconsider your plan.
Using a public internet connection is not wise in many cases, as it immediately eliminates a few layers of site security.
If you are betting online for real money and you have a login, personal information, and deposit method stored in the player accounts, it is a bad idea to use public connections.
Use strong passwords.
Another best practise to keep your information safe is to create your casino betting account with a complex password with different types of characters.
Then follow up by changing that password regularly.

The term “Rogues’ Gallery” dates back to the 1800s. The Pinkerton Detective Agency and then the New York City Police Department used it to describe their collections of mugshots.
In the 20th century, comic book heroes like Batman faced off with their own Rogues Gallery, featuring super villains like The Joker, Penguin, and The Riddler.
Today, there is a new Rogues Gallery made up of online casinos that are anything but safe. It’s like a mugshot book for players, warning them to stay away.
This online casino’s Rogues Gallery is also known as a casino blacklist.
